Florida Issues Statewide Travel Advisory Amidst World Cup Concerns

As the world gears up for the highly anticipated 2026 FIFA World Cup, a significant concern has emerged for international visitors planning to travel to Florida. A coalition of prominent civil and human rights organizations has issued a statewide travel alert for the Sunshine State, urging extreme caution for those intending to visit, particularly in light of enhanced immigration enforcement measures.

The advisory warns that stepped-up immigration enforcement in Florida could inadvertently increase the risk of racial profiling, wrongful detentions, and even deportations for international visitors. The groups are strongly advising tourists and visiting football fans to carry identification at all times and to register their travel plans with their respective consulates before their arrival.

Furthermore, the coalition recommends that travelers seriously reconsider their plans to visit Florida until perceived issues of accountability and transparency in enforcement practices are adequately addressed.

“Florida is no longer a safe destination for international tourists,” stated Tessa Petit, Executive Director of the Florida Immigrant Coalition. She expressed concerns that both visitors and residents could face detention without just cause and be unfairly targeted based on their appearance, language, or accent.

Tourism Officials Rebuff Travel Advisory

The travel alert has been met with strong criticism from Florida’s tourism officials, who have dismissed the warnings as politically motivated and detrimental to the state’s economy and tourism industry.

Bryan Griffin, President and CEO of the tourism group Visit Florida, vehemently refuted the claims. “These ‘advisories’ are ridiculous and, unfortunately, politically-motivated stunts that needlessly seek to harm our state and industry,” Griffin stated. He emphasized that lawful visitors have nothing to fear and that Florida eagerly anticipates welcoming hundreds of thousands of travelers for what is expected to be a vibrant hub for World Cup celebrations. “Visitors can expect an enjoyable, safe, and easy travel experience in Florida,” he assured.

Basis for the Travel Alert

The coalition’s concerns are reportedly rooted in documented instances reported by journalists and other civil rights organizations. These reports detail cases where U.S. citizens, lawful permanent residents, and tourists have allegedly been detained following routine interactions with law enforcement, including traffic stops.

The organizations also highlighted accounts of individuals being held for extended periods with limited access to legal counsel or consular assistance. While Reuters could not independently verify the specific incidents cited in the advisory, the coalition’s claims underscore a broader concern about the potential for overreach in immigration enforcement.

A key factor contributing to the coalition’s apprehension is Florida’s expanded cooperation between local law enforcement agencies and federal immigration authorities. This collaboration empowers trained local officers to undertake certain immigration enforcement functions. Civil liberties advocates argue that such arrangements can lead to the over-policing of immigrant communities. Conversely, proponents of these programs maintain that they are essential for enhancing public safety.

World Cup Context and Miami’s Role

The issuance of this travel alert comes at a critical juncture as the United States prepares to co-host the 2026 FIFA World Cup. The tournament, scheduled to run from June 11 to July 19, is expected to attract hundreds of thousands of international visitors to various host cities across the country. Miami, in particular, is slated to host seven matches of the expanded 48-team global football spectacle.

The U.S. is sharing hosting duties for this prestigious event with its North American neighbors, Canada and Mexico, creating a unique cross-border tournament experience. The influx of diverse international fans and participants underscores the importance of ensuring a safe and welcoming environment for all. The travel advisory, therefore, casts a shadow over the optimistic outlook for the World Cup’s success in Florida, highlighting a tension between enhanced security measures and the rights and freedoms of individuals.
